Aller au contenu

Ubuntu + VMWare


eudom

Messages recommandés

Posté(e)

Bonjour!

J'ai installé Ubuntu (la dernière version) sur un PC cette après midi.

Et maintenant je veux installer VMWare.

J'ai donc téléchargé le tarball, décompressé, lancé l'installation, répondu aux "questions" ...etc. mais arrivé à un moment de la configuration il bloque sur l'erreur suivante :

Building the VMware VmPerl Scripting API.

Using compiler "/usr/bin/gcc". Use environment variable CC to override.

Unable to compile the VMware VmPerl Scripting API.

********

The VMware VmPerl Scripting API was not installed. Errors encountered during

compilation and installation of the module can be found here:

/tmp/vmware-config2

You will not be able to use the "vmware-cmd" program.

Errors can be found in the log file:

'/tmp/vmware-config2/control-only/make.log'

********

Hit enter to continue.

Que faire? Ou plus exactement comment installer VMWare VmPerl Scripting API ? ;)

Merci ;)

Posté(e)
Building the VMware VmPerl Scripting API.

Errors can be found in the log file:

'/tmp/vmware-config2/control-only/make.log'

Pourrait-on avoir le contenu de ce fichier pour voir ce qui bloque ?

Posté(e)

Checking if your kit is complete...

Looks good

Writing Makefile for VMware::VmPerl

make: Entering directory `/tmp/vmware-config2/control-only'

cp VmPerl/VM.pm blib/lib/VMware/VmPerl/VM.pm

cp Control.pm blib/lib/VMware/Control.pm

AutoSplitting blib/lib/VMware/Control.pm (blib/lib/auto/VMware/Control)

cp Profiler.pm blib/lib/VMware/Control/Profiler.pm

AutoSplitting blib/lib/VMware/Control/Profiler.pm (blib/lib/auto/VMware/Control$

cp VmPerl/ConnectParams.pm blib/lib/VMware/VmPerl/ConnectParams.pm

cp Server.pm blib/lib/VMware/Control/Server.pm

cp Keycode.pm blib/lib/VMware/Control/Keycode.pm

cp VMScript.pm blib/lib/VMware/Control/VMScript.pm

cp VmPerl/VmPerl.pm blib/lib/VMware/VmPerl.pm

AutoSplitting blib/lib/VMware/VmPerl.pm (blib/lib/auto/VMware/VmPerl)

cp VmPerl/Server.pm blib/lib/VMware/VmPerl/Server.pm

cp VM.pm blib/lib/VMware/Control/VM.pm

cp VmPerl/Question.pm blib/lib/VMware/VmPerl/Question.pm

In file included from VmPerl.xs:6:

/usr/lib/perl/5.8/CORE/perl.h:382:24: error: sys/types.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:413:19: error: ctype.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:425:23: error: locale.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:442:20: error: setjmp.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:448:26: error: sys/param.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:453:23: error: stdlib.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:458:23: error: unistd.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:731:23: error: string.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:880:27: error: netinet/in.h: No such file or dire$

/usr/lib/perl/5.8/CORE/perl.h:884:26: error: arpa/inet.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:894:25: error: sys/stat.h: No such file or direct$

/usr/lib/perl/5.8/CORE/perl.h:916:21: error: time.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:923:25: error: sys/time.h: No such file or direct$

/usr/lib/perl/5.8/CORE/perl.h:930:27: error: sys/times.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:937:19: error: errno.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:952:25: error: sys/socket.h: No such file or dire$

/usr/lib/perl/5.8/CORE/perl.h:979:21: error: netdb.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:1081:24: error: sys/ioctl.h: No such file or dire$

...etc

Posté(e)

Checking if your kit is complete...

Looks good

Writing Makefile for VMware::VmPerl

make: Entering directory `/tmp/vmware-config2/control-only'

cp VmPerl/VM.pm blib/lib/VMware/VmPerl/VM.pm

cp Control.pm blib/lib/VMware/Control.pm

AutoSplitting blib/lib/VMware/Control.pm (blib/lib/auto/VMware/Control)

cp Profiler.pm blib/lib/VMware/Control/Profiler.pm

AutoSplitting blib/lib/VMware/Control/Profiler.pm (blib/lib/auto/VMware/Control$

cp VmPerl/ConnectParams.pm blib/lib/VMware/VmPerl/ConnectParams.pm

cp Server.pm blib/lib/VMware/Control/Server.pm

cp Keycode.pm blib/lib/VMware/Control/Keycode.pm

cp VMScript.pm blib/lib/VMware/Control/VMScript.pm

cp VmPerl/VmPerl.pm blib/lib/VMware/VmPerl.pm

AutoSplitting blib/lib/VMware/VmPerl.pm (blib/lib/auto/VMware/VmPerl)

cp VmPerl/Server.pm blib/lib/VMware/VmPerl/Server.pm

cp VM.pm blib/lib/VMware/Control/VM.pm

cp VmPerl/Question.pm blib/lib/VMware/VmPerl/Question.pm

In file included from VmPerl.xs:6:

/usr/lib/perl/5.8/CORE/perl.h:382:24: error: sys/types.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:413:19: error: ctype.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:425:23: error: locale.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:442:20: error: setjmp.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:448:26: error: sys/param.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:453:23: error: stdlib.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:458:23: error: unistd.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:731:23: error: string.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:880:27: error: netinet/in.h: No such file or dire$

/usr/lib/perl/5.8/CORE/perl.h:884:26: error: arpa/inet.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:894:25: error: sys/stat.h: No such file or direct$

/usr/lib/perl/5.8/CORE/perl.h:916:21: error: time.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:923:25: error: sys/time.h: No such file or direct$

/usr/lib/perl/5.8/CORE/perl.h:930:27: error: sys/times.h: No such file or direc$

/usr/lib/perl/5.8/CORE/perl.h:937:19: error: errno.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:952:25: error: sys/socket.h: No such file or dire$

/usr/lib/perl/5.8/CORE/perl.h:979:21: error: netdb.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:1081:24: error: sys/ioctl.h: No such file or dire$

...etc

réessaie après l'installation du paquet libperl-dev (sudo aptitude install libperl-dev)... Apparemment des entêtes de développement de Perl qui manquent.

Posté(e)
eudom@eudom-desktop:~$ sudo aptitude install libperl-dev

Lecture des listes de paquets... Fait

Construction de l'arbre des dépendances... Fait

Initialisation de l'état des paquets... Fait

Construction de la base de données des étiquettes... Fait

Impossible de trouver un paquet dont le nom ou la description correspond à «Â libperl-dev »

Aucun paquet ne va être installé, mis à jour ou enlevé.

0 paquets mis à jour, 0 nouvellement installés, 0 à enlever et 0 non mis à j our.

Il est nécessaire de télécharger 0o d'archives. Après dépaquetage, 0o seron t utilisés.

eudom@eudom-desktop:~$

Bon je viens d'installer "libperl-dev_5.8.7-10ubuntu1_i386", je réessaie la compile de VMWare

Edit: Je viens de relancer l'installation, mais toujours le même problème :

In file included from VmPerl.xs:6:

/usr/lib/perl/5.8/CORE/perl.h:382:24: error: sys/types.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:413:19: error: ctype.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:425:23: error: locale.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:442:20: error: setjmp.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:448:26: error: sys/param.h: No such file or directory

Posté(e)
In file included from VmPerl.xs:6:

/usr/lib/perl/5.8/CORE/perl.h:382:24: error: sys/types.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:413:19: error: ctype.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:425:23: error: locale.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:442:20: error: setjmp.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:448:26: error: sys/param.h: No such file or directory

Il faut sans doute le paquet libc6-dev

Posté(e)
In file included from VmPerl.xs:6:

/usr/lib/perl/5.8/CORE/perl.h:382:24: error: sys/types.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:413:19: error: ctype.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:425:23: error: locale.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:442:20: error: setjmp.h: No such file or directory

/usr/lib/perl/5.8/CORE/perl.h:448:26: error: sys/param.h: No such file or directory

Il faut sans doute le paquet libc6-dev

J'avais du l'installer aussi ce paquet...

Et il va te manquer aussi les headers de ton kernel...

Posté(e)

Merci, j'essaie tout ça de suite.

Comment on trouve les headers du kernel svp?

Youpi :byebye:

Ca avance! Ce problème est passé :roll:

Maintenant il me dit que le numéro de série est invalide :transpi::D:byebye:

Posté(e)

Maintenant il me dit que le numéro de série est invalide :reflechis::nimp::mdr2:

VMware est une société, et commercialise ses logiciels :-D

Que tu aies téléchargé VMware Workstation ou VMware Server, il te faut un serial, qui dans le premier cas te donne une évaluation limitée dans le temps, dans le deuxième cas te donne accès au programme sans limite de temps (VMware Server est gratuit). Va t'enregistrer sur www.vmware.com, c'est gratuit :transpi:

Posté(e)

Oui ben en fait je me suis enregistré et tout, j'ai bien reçu 2 serials par mail (une linux, l'autre windows) mais ça ne marche pas :chinois::arrow::arrow:

Posté(e)

VMWare Server 1.0 | 7/10/06 | Build 28343 qui est gratuit.

J'ai reçu par mail le lien pour le télécharger ainsi que les numéros de série.

Type XXXXX-XXXXX-XXXXX-XXXXX or 'Enter' to cancel: 98JM9-YHRAN-1A0FQ-4KHRW

The serial number 98JM9-YHRAN-1A0FQ-4KHRW is invalid.

Please enter your 20-character serial number.

Type XXXXX-XXXXX-XXXXX-XXXXX or 'Enter' to cancel:

Posté(e)
Déja, faut prendre vmware workstation qui pour moi est le top (sauf si t'as un biproc mais c'est une autre histoire)

Sauf que VMware workstation n'est gratuit que pour un temps limité, après il est très cher où alors c'est du WareZ, et cette dernière pratique n'a pas cours sur PCI :zarb:

Posté(e)
Déja, faut prendre vmware workstation qui pour moi est le top (sauf si t'as un biproc mais c'est une autre histoire)

Sauf que VMware workstation n'est gratuit que pour un temps limité, après il est très cher où alors c'est du WareZ, et cette dernière pratique n'a pas cours sur PCI :bretagne:

Je n'en ai point parlé :transpi:

Oui c'est vrai il est payant mais il va moulte bien donc c'est compensé...

Archivé

Ce sujet est désormais archivé et ne peut plus recevoir de nouvelles réponses.

×
×
  • Créer...